Dartmoor Symphony
This album is a very special new work that forms part of a series of compositions based on the Dartmoor landscape and which, at last, offers an opportunity to hear Nigel's music performed within a live orchestral context.
This double album (involving CD and DVD) is a deeply personal and profound expression of the extraordinary beauty and power of this ancient landscape, drawn from many years of intimate connection with the moors and a constantly evolving journey into how the voices of nature can be expressed through traditional, classical and indigenous instruments.

Seven
Stones
This is a beautiful and dynamic
recording reflecting aspects of the
sacred landscape both without and
within. The seven movements are
each a key for entry into the
circle of life and each represents
a foundation stone of our
nature.
The music features richly
interwoven melodies and rhythms
created on native American cedar
flutes, samples (including flutes,
harp, ocarina, cimbala),
synthesisers, drums and percussion,
and voices.
